Abstract

The present invention relates to a kind of wrap-up, more particularly to a kind of adjustable wrap-up of electric power cable.The technical problem to be solved in the present invention is to provide it is a kind of can to electric power with cable wind it is more compact, uniformly and can remove the adjustable wrap-up of electric power cable for being repaired or being preserved.In order to solve the above-mentioned technical problem, the invention provides such a adjustable wrap-up of electric power cable, top plate etc. is included;Top plate bottom right side is connected with motor, and motor bottom is connected with the first bull stick, and the first bull stick bottom is connected with reel, kelly is connected with the middle part of reel left wall, hole clipping is provided with kelly, fixed mechanism is connected with reel, reel lower outside is connected with elevating mechanism.The present invention devises a kind of adjustable wrap-up of electric power cable, and the first wedge and the second wedge of setting enable lever to block electric power cable when electric power is being wound with cable, has reached and has cleaned effect that is cleaner, comprehensive and being moved easily.

Technical field
The present invention relates to a kind of wrap-up, more particularly to a kind of adjustable wrap-up of electric power cable.
Background technology
Power cable is the cable for transmitting and distributing electric energy, and power cable is usually used in Urban Underground power network, power station Lead line, industrial and mining enterprises' in-line power and mistake river sea submarine transmission line.
Electric power is usually that cable is wound using closed reel with cable winding at present, and this kind of winding mode is not only received Volume speed is slow and is easy in winding so that electric power cable injustice directly, causes the cable of winding is not compact to be easy to be pulled Out.
Therefore need badly research and development one kind can to electric power with cable wind it is more compact, uniformly and can remove and repaired or protected The adjustable wrap-up of electric power cable deposited, come overcome in the prior art closed reel electric power cable is wound it is not compact, no The shortcomings that uniformly and maintenance can not being removed or preserved.

(2)Technical scheme
In order to solve the above-mentioned technical problem, the invention provides such a adjustable wrap-up of electric power cable, include Top plate, motor, the first bull stick, reel, kelly, fixed mechanism and elevating mechanism, top plate bottom right side are connected with motor, motor Bottom is connected with the first bull stick, and the first bull stick bottom is connected with reel, is connected with kelly in the middle part of reel left wall, is opened on kelly There is hole clipping, fixed mechanism is connected with reel, reel lower outside is connected with elevating mechanism.
Preferably, fixed mechanism includes lever, the first wedge, the first spring, the first elevating lever and the second wedge, Four sides are provided with first through hole up and down on reel top or so, and lever is provided with first through hole, first is respectively connected with the inside of lever Wedge, is respectively connected with the first spring between the first wedge and reel inwall, reel bottom is provided with the second through hole, and second The first elevating lever is provided with through hole, the first elevating lever top and middle part are respectively connected with the second wedge, the second wedge and first Wedge coordinates, and the second wedge and the first wedge shape are respectively positioned in reel.
Preferably, elevating mechanism includes latch closure, drawstring, connecting rod, the first directive wheel, the second directive wheel and the first lifting Plate, reel top left and right sides bottom are respectively connected with latch closure, and there is drawstring in latch closure bottom system, connected at left and right sides of reel bottom Connecting rod is connected to, connecting rod bottom is respectively connected with the first directive wheel, the second directive wheel is symmetrically connected with left and right sides of reel bottom, left The drawstring of right both sides bypasses the first directive wheel and the second directive wheel, and drawstring bottom is connected with the first lifter plate, the first lifter plate It is connected with the first elevating lever.
Preferably, guide rod and the 3rd directive wheel are also included, top plate left bottom is connected with guide rod, opened in guide rod There is a pilot hole, the 3rd directive wheel is symmetrically connected with up and down in the middle part of the outer wall at left and right sides of guide rod.
Preferably, also include the second elevating lever, the second lifter plate, second spring, lifting wheel, treadle and the 4th to be oriented to Wheel, top plate left side are provided with third through-hole, and third through-hole is located on the right side of guide rod, and third through-hole and the second elevating lever coordinate, and second The second lifter plate is connected with the top of elevating lever, second spring, the second bullet are connected between the second lifter plate bottom and top plate top Spring bypasses the second elevating lever, and the second elevating lever bottom is connected with lifting wheel, and lifting wheel bottom is connected with treadle, connected on the left of top plate There is the 4th directive wheel, the 4th directive wheel is located on the right side of lifting wheel, and the top of the 4th directive wheel and the bottom of lifting wheel are in same Horizontal line.
Preferably, mobile bar, gear, rack, head rod, bearing block, the second bull stick, worm gear, worm screw are also included With the 3rd connecting rod, lifting wheel bottom is connected with mobile bar, is connected with rack on front side of mobile bar, and top plate bottom left is connected with the One connecting rod, head rod is between the second elevating lever and guide rod, and on the downside of head rod and left side is respectively connected with axle Bearing, the second bull stick is connected with the bearing block in left side, worm screw is connected with the top of the second bull stick, is connected with the bearing block on right side 3rd connecting rod, the 3rd connecting rod left side are connected with worm gear, and worm screw is located on front side of worm gear, worm gear and worm engaging, the 3rd connection Gear is connected with the right side of bar, gear is located on front side of rack, wheel and rack engagement.
Preferably, also include mounting rod and bolt, mounting rod, the first bull stick top and installation are connected with the top of reel Screwed hole is provided with the middle part of bar, and screwed hole is in same horizontal line, and bolt is inserted with screwed hole, bolt coordinates with screwed hole.
Operation principle:When needing the present apparatus to wind electric power with cable, user of service is first by for the electric power of winding It is stuck in the head of cable in hole clipping, user of service controls fixed mechanism by controlling elevating mechanism so that fixed mechanism is outside Mobile, when being moved to certain distance and can be controlled fixed with cable to electric power, user of service enables motor, so that Reel is wound to electric power with cable.
Because fixed mechanism includes lever, the first wedge, the first spring, the first elevating lever and the second wedge, receive Four sides are provided with first through hole up and down on reel top or so, and lever is provided with first through hole, first wedge is respectively connected with the inside of lever Shape block, the first spring is respectively connected between the first wedge and reel inwall, reel bottom is provided with the second through hole, and second is logical The first elevating lever is provided with hole, the first elevating lever top and middle part are respectively connected with the second wedge, the second wedge and first wedge Shape block coordinates, and the second wedge and the first wedge shape are respectively positioned in reel, when the present apparatus is being wound to electric power with cable, User of service by controlling the elevating lever of elevating mechanism first to move up, the first elevating lever will cause the second wedge also to Upper movement, when the second wedge, which moves upward to, to be contacted with the first wedge, the second wedge continued up will The first wedge of the left and right sides is promoted to move out, now the first spring-compressed, the lever of the left and right sides is also by outside sidesway It is dynamic, lever is fixed by mobile fix when lever is moved to certain distance, when electric power is wound with cable to be completed, made Motor is closed with personnel, the first bull stick will stop operating, and the first bull stick causes reel to stop operating, so that electric power electricity consumption Cable stops winding, and now by controlling the elevating lever of elevating mechanism first to move down, the first spring will recover user of service Original state, the first spring, which restores to the original state, causes the lever side movement inwards of the left and right sides, so that the first wedge shape of the left and right sides Block also move inwards by side, and when the first wedge contacts with the second wedge, spring does not restore to the original state also completely, so that left First wedge of right both sides continues side inwards and moved, and now the first wedge causes the second wedge to move down, so as to band Dynamic first elevating lever also moves down, and the first wedge and the second wedge of setting cause lever being wound in electric power cable When can block electric power cable, wound it uniform, unimpeded, prevent electric power with cable winding when be wound into reel Outside, when lever is moved in first through hole, user of service can by the electric power cable wound from the outside of reel from It is up to lower to take out.
Because elevating mechanism includes latch closure, drawstring, connecting rod, the first directive wheel, the second directive wheel and the first lifter plate, receive Bottom is respectively connected with latch closure at left and right sides of reel top, and there is drawstring in latch closure bottom system, is respectively connected with left and right sides of reel bottom Connecting rod, connecting rod bottom are respectively connected with the first directive wheel, the second directive wheel, left and right two are symmetrically connected with left and right sides of reel bottom The drawstring of side bypasses the first directive wheel and the second directive wheel, and drawstring bottom is connected with the first lifter plate, the first lifter plate and One elevating lever connects, and when reel is being wound to electric power with cable, user of service pulls up the drawstring of the left and right sides, The drawstring of the left and right sides is moved up by the lifter plate of effect first of the first directive wheel and the second directive wheel, the first lifting Plate, which moves up, will drive the first elevating lever to move up, and the first elevating lever moves upwardly so that the lever of the left and right sides is outside Side is moved, and when lever is moved to certain distance, user of service ties up to drawstring on latch closure, is completed when electric power is wound with cable When, user of service unties the drawstring tied up on latch closure, in the presence of the gravity of the first lifter plate and the first spring restore to the original state, First lifter plate will move down and return to home position.
Because also including and also including guide rod and the 3rd directive wheel, top plate left bottom is connected with guide rod, is oriented to It is provided with pilot hole in bar, the 3rd directive wheel is symmetrically connected with up and down in the middle part of the outer wall at left and right sides of guide rod, when needs pair When electric power is wound with cable, between electric power is put into the 3rd directive wheel of upper and lower both sides with the head of cable by user of service, then Electric power cable, under the drive of the upper and lower directive wheel of both sides the 3rd, sidesway of turning right that electric power cable will be straight are promoted to the right Move to hole clipping, the 3rd directive wheel of setting enables electric power cable is straight to be moved in hole clipping, prevents because electric power is used Cable is not straight and causes the electric power that winding is got up uneven straight, the influence outward appearance of cable.
Because also including the second elevating lever, the second lifter plate, second spring, lifting wheel, treadle and the 4th directive wheel, top Third through-hole is provided with the left of plate, third through-hole is located on the right side of guide rod, and third through-hole and the second elevating lever coordinate, the second elevating lever Top is connected with the second lifter plate, is connected with second spring between the second lifter plate bottom and top plate top, second spring bypasses Second elevating lever, the second elevating lever bottom are connected with lifting wheel, and lifting wheel bottom is connected with treadle, the 4th is connected with the left of top plate Directive wheel, the 4th directive wheel are located on the right side of lifting wheel, and the top of the 4th directive wheel and the bottom of lifting wheel are in same horizontal line, When electric power is loose with cable winding, in order that the electric power cable for being wound in reel is more compact, user of service's pin Slam treadle to move down, treadle will drive the second elevating lever to move down by lifting wheel, and now second spring is compressed, and rises Drop wheel will be pressed downward passing through the electric power cable of lifting wheel so that electric power cable becomes more compact, afterwards electric power electricity consumption Cable continues to move right to be passed through at the top of the 4th directive wheel, and when electric power is wound with cable to be completed, user of service decontrols treadle, the Two springs restore to the original state, and so as to drive the second elevating lever to move up, lifting wheel will also restore to the original state, and the lifting wheel of setting causes It can be compressed when electric power is more loose with cable so that the electric power cable of winding is more compact.
Because also include mobile bar, gear, rack, head rod, bearing block, the second bull stick, worm gear, worm screw and Three connecting rods, lifting wheel bottom are connected with mobile bar, are connected with rack on front side of mobile bar, top plate bottom left is connected with the first company Extension bar, head rod is between the second elevating lever and guide rod, and on the downside of head rod and left side is respectively connected with bearing block, The second bull stick is connected with the bearing block in left side, worm screw is connected with the top of the second bull stick, the 3rd is connected with the bearing block on right side Connecting rod, the 3rd connecting rod left side are connected with worm gear, and worm screw is located on front side of worm gear, worm gear and worm engaging, and the 3rd connecting rod is right Side is connected with gear, and gear is located on front side of rack, wheel and rack engagement, when lifting wheel to be made is compressed to electric power with cable When, user of service rotates clockwise the second bull stick, and the second bull stick, which rotates clockwise, to drive worm screw to rotate clockwise, so that Obtain worm gear to rotate counterclockwise, worm gear, which rotates counterclockwise, will drive the 3rd connecting rod to rotate clockwise, so that gear up time Pin is rotated, and then rack is just moved down, and electric power is extruded with cable so that lifting wheel moves down, when electric power is used When cable winding is completed, due to the characteristic of worm and gear individual event transmission, user of service's second bull stick that stops operating will not cause snail Bar rotates counterclockwise, user of service stop operating the second bull stick when, second spring restore to the original state so that lifting wheel moves up back To original position, the second bull stick of setting causes user of service to trample bar with pin, can rotate the second bull stick by hand to control Lifting wheel so that user of service can more easily control lifting wheel.
Because also including mounting rod and bolt, mounting rod, the first bull stick top and mounting rod are connected with the top of reel Middle part is provided with screwed hole, and screwed hole is in same horizontal line, and bolt is inserted with screwed hole, and bolt coordinates with screwed hole, when When reel completes the work of winding electric power cable, user of service can back-out the bolt in screwed hole, afterwards again by the One bull stick is taken away from mounting rod, and user of service can individually take off reel, and bolt and the screwed hole of setting to make Can be taken off to be repaired or deposited when being finished reel with personnel avoids reel from being in throughout the year in air Damaged by dust.
